Incorporate a Statement Mirror

stylish reflective staircase accentPin

A statement mirror can instantly elevate your staircase wall from simple to stunning, serving as a mesmerizing focal point that draws the eye upward.

Choose a mirror with an eye-catching shape—be it an ornate oval, a sleek geometric design, or a vintage-inspired frame—to add personality and depth.

Position it strategically so it reflects natural light, making the space feel brighter and more expansive.

Consider layering it with wall sconces or subtle accent lighting to highlight its design.

The mirror’s size should complement the wall, neither overwhelming nor getting lost among other decor.

This piece becomes a functional art form, capturing your style while bouncing light around your staircase, transforming a mundane feature into a striking visual statement.

Arrange a Symmetrical Pattern of Frames

symmetrical frame arrangement tipsPin

Creating a symmetrical pattern of frames instantly elevates your staircase wall by introducing a sense of harmony and order.

To accomplish this, choose frames of similar size and style, then carefully plan your layout on the floor first. Visualize a grid or mirror-image arrangement, aligning the edges with precision.

Use a level to ensure straight lines and consistent spacing, which reinforces the balanced look. Incorporate a mix of artwork, photos, or prints that complement each other, but keep the arrangement centered around a focal point or theme.

This method creates a cohesive display that draws the eye smoothly along the staircase, transforming an ordinary wall into a polished gallery that exudes sophistication and intentional design.

Use Wallpaper or Wall Coverings for Texture and Pattern

add patterned wall coveringsPin

Enhancing your staircase wall with wallpaper or wall coverings introduces a dynamic layer of texture and pattern that can dramatically transform the space. Think beyond plain paint—choose bold florals, geometric designs, or vintage motifs that catch the eye.

Textured wall coverings, like grasscloth or embossed vinyl, add tactile interest and depth under your fingertips. When selecting a pattern, consider scale: large motifs create a statement, while subtle designs add sophistication without overwhelming.

You can also experiment with colors—rich jewel tones or soft pastels—to set the mood. Applying wallpaper or coverings allows you to customize your staircase, making it uniquely yours.

Just ensure the pattern complements your overall decor style and enhances the architectural lines of your staircase.
